- Change Control: Public/Stable
- Permissions: The job_sort_formula must be set by the admin (e.g., root).
- Summary: A number between 0 and 1 representing the job's entities usage modified to take it's location in the fairshare tree into account.
- Details:
- A number between 0 and 1. Higher numbers are less deserving.
- This number is somewhat arbitrary. It's based on the actual usage of the entity and its location in the fairshare tree, but isn't directly comparable with any other entity's fairshare_tree_usage.
- The below formula refers to this keyword as effective usage.
- NOTE: the formula is calculated once at the start of the cycle. This factor will not be updated during the cycle (e.g., after jobs run).

Something to note: summing all of the effective usages of all of the entities will be more than 100%. This doesn't allow for direct comparison between the entities.
The effective usage keyword in the formula is 'fairshare_tree_usage'
Here is a formula to provide a direct comparison between entities. It is not the only one, but it will work well. It results in a number between 0 and 1. A result of .5 means the entity is on target.
